Schneider, George was born on October 29, 1939 in Boston, Massachusetts, United States. Son of Morris and Doris (Saslovsky) Schneider.
AB, Harvard University, 1961; Doctor of Medicine, Tufts U., Boston, 1965.
Intern, Bellevue Hospital, New York City, 1965-1966; assistant resident, Bellevue Hospital, New York City, 1966-1967; associate resident, Strong Memorial Hospital, Rochester, New York, 1969-1970; fellow, Yale University School of Medicine, New Haven, Connecticut, 1970-1972; chief of endocrinology, Veterans Administration Hospital., East Orange, New Jersey, 1972-1980; chief of endocrinology, Beth Israel Medical Center, Newark, since 1980; private practice endocrinology, Roseland, New Jersey, since 1980; chief endocrinology, Beth Israel Hospital, Newark, since 1980. Medical director diabetes treatement center Beth Israel Hospital, Newark, since 1986.
Lieutenant commander United States Public Health Service, 1967-1969. Fellow American College of Physicians, American College Endocrinology. Member American Medical Association, Academy Medicine of New Jersey, American Diabetes Association, Endocrine Society, Alpha Omega Alpha.
Married Patricia Marian Seymour, August 2, 1964. Children: Andrew Gordon, Pamela Robin.
